public inbox for cgroups@vger.kernel.org
 help / color / mirror / Atom feed
* ps stuck on cmdline reading
@ 2015-01-21  9:58 William Dauchy
       [not found] ` <20150121095808.GA18656-M8Sm6a3kpgNeoWH0uzbU5w@public.gmane.org>
  0 siblings, 1 reply; 5+ messages in thread
From: William Dauchy @ 2015-01-21  9:58 UTC (permalink / raw)
  To: cgroups-u79uwXL29TY76Z2rM5mHXA

[-- Attachment #1: Type: text/plain, Size: 934 bytes --]

Hello,

I am sometines triggering an issue on a v3.14.x (v3.14.18 here) where
the `ps auxwwf` is stuck.
The setup is several containers which own several process and with
memory limit on each cgroup.
A strace reveals the `ps` command is stuck on a read of a cmdline
file. The concerned process itself is on a non-interruptible IO state.
The ps command is executed in the global cgroup.

I also had a similar issue on a 3.10.x some months ago where ps was
stuck; the reason was the memory limit of the cgroup was reached and I
only had to add some pages available to the conatiner in order to
unlock the ps command.
But in my case the cgroups which own the pid has still lots of memory
available and I did not found a way to unlock the process.

I don't know how to reproduce the issue but I am sometimes triggering
it.

Does someone has some hint? How can I get more debug info about it?

Thanks,
-- 
William

[-- Attachment #2: Digital signature --]
[-- Type: application/pgp-signature, Size: 181 bytes --]

^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2015-02-10 15:10 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2015-01-21  9:58 ps stuck on cmdline reading William Dauchy
     [not found] ` <20150121095808.GA18656-M8Sm6a3kpgNeoWH0uzbU5w@public.gmane.org>
2015-02-03 19:40   ` Michal Hocko
     [not found]     ` <20150203194036.GA2490-2MMpYkNvuYDjFM9bn6wA6Q@public.gmane.org>
2015-02-05 15:22       ` William Dauchy
     [not found]         ` <20150205152233.GI3008-M8Sm6a3kpgNeoWH0uzbU5w@public.gmane.org>
2015-02-05 15:45           ` Michal Hocko
     [not found]             ` <20150205154558.GF19104-2MMpYkNvuYDjFM9bn6wA6Q@public.gmane.org>
2015-02-10 15:10               ` William Dauchy

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ox